Flavia Rooftop Apartments in Rome, Italy, is a welcoming haven for families and road-trippers alike. Situated on Via Flavia 96, this property offers a strategic base to explore the Eternal City’s rich history and vibrant culture. With family rooms designed to accommodate everyone comfortably, it’s a top choice for those traveling with children.
Guests have praised the spaciousness of the apartments, allowing families to unwind together after a day of sightseeing. The rooftop terrace serves as a tranquil spot for relaxation, where you can enjoy a glass of wine while taking in the views of the city. Reviewers often highlight the convenience of having a fully equipped kitchen, making meal preparations easy and budget-friendly for families on the go.
In terms of location, Flavia Rooftop Apartments is well positioned to access some of Rome's most iconic landmarks. The Trevi Fountain is just 1.5 kilometers away, inviting you to toss a coin and make a wish. A short 2-kilometer stroll leads you to the Roman Forum, where history comes alive among the ruins. Families can also reach the Vatican City in about 30 minutes, offering a chance to explore St. Peter's Basilica and the Vatican Museums.
The property is non-smoking throughout and equipped with air conditioning, ensuring a comfortable stay. With free wired internet, staying connected for planning your next adventure is hassle-free. The nearby Termini Train Station, 1 kilometer away, provides easy access for road trips and excursions beyond the city.

Via Flavia 96 places you within a few kilometers of Rome’s headline attractions, including Trevi Fountain (1.5 km), the Roman Forum (2 km), and the Colosseum (2.5 km). Vatican City is also reachable at about 3 km, making this a practical base for a multi-day history route. If you’re relying on transit, the property lists an accessible train station shuttle, which can help offset the fact that parking is not available.
